“Mitga’age’a” Pini Einhorn In A Touching Single With A Resonant Message
Each of us has moments in life of distance, falling, or a sense of missing out, where it seems we’ve lost our way. Pini Einhorn‘s new song, “Mitga’age’a” (Missing), written according to the words of Rabbi Pinchas from Koritz, brings a simple and comforting message that goes straight to the heart: The further a person moves away from Hashem, the more Hashem’s longing for him only grows.
The new single officially opens the way to Pini‘s fourth album, and takes on special significance these days ahead of Pini‘s traditional Selichot ceremony. The lyrics were written by Yair Shoval, and he also composed it together with Moshe Roth, the musical production of Yair & Eyal Shriki.
